Output a75e3e8b07817cf6a4b6ac9ea68b713974e6353cb1cc3ae167c70bd0b996992e:0

value
39285931
script pubkey
OP_0 OP_PUSHBYTES_20 e50676bfae7f43fe484b2063349a5200eb93fba0
address
tb1qu5r8d0aw0aplujztyp3nfxjjqr4e87aq3a37fj
transaction
a75e3e8b07817cf6a4b6ac9ea68b713974e6353cb1cc3ae167c70bd0b996992e
confirmations
25706
spent
true